Unity调试工具零基础配置指南:从安装到深度应用
【免费下载链接】UnityExplorerAn in-game UI for exploring, debugging and modifying IL2CPP and Mono Unity games.项目地址: https://gitcode.com/gh_mirrors/un/UnityExplorer
Unity游戏调试是提升开发效率的关键环节,而UnityExplorer作为一款功能强大的实时对象检查工具,为MOD开发和游戏调试提供了全方位支持。本文将从价值定位、场景选择、实施指南到深度应用,帮助零基础用户快速掌握这款工具的配置与使用,让你的调试工作事半功倍。
价值定位:UnityExplorer为何是调试必备工具
UnityExplorer是一款专为Unity游戏打造的调试神器,它能够在游戏运行时提供实时的对象检查、代码执行和场景探索功能。无论你是经验丰富的游戏开发者还是刚入门的MOD制作者,这款工具都能满足你的需求。它支持从Unity 5.2到2021+的绝大多数版本,无论是加密还是非加密游戏引擎都能完美兼容。通过UnityExplorer,你可以实时查看和修改游戏对象属性、执行C#代码进行调试、搜索和管理场景资源,以及创建方法钩子进行深度分析,极大地提升你的调试效率。
场景选择:如何根据需求选择合适的安装方式
在选择UnityExplorer的安装方式时,我们可以通过以下决策树来确定最适合自己的方案:
- 是否已安装BepInEx框架?
- 是 → 选择BepInEx安装方式
- 否 → 进入下一步
- 是否需要高级功能且不介意安装额外框架?
- 是 → 选择MelonLoader安装方式
- 否 → 选择Standalone独立安装方式
实施指南:三种安装方式的详细步骤
BepInEx安装方式(推荐)
准备:确保游戏已安装BepInEx框架,下载UnityExplorer的BepInEx版本。
执行:
- 将下载的UnityExplorer文件复制到游戏的BepInEx/plugins目录。
- 启动游戏,等待BepInEx加载完成。
验证:按F7键,若能成功打开UnityExplorer界面,则安装成功。
MelonLoader安装方式
准备:确保游戏已安装MelonLoader框架,下载UnityExplorer的MelonLoader版本。
执行:
- 将下载的UnityExplorer文件复制到游戏的Mods目录。
- 启动游戏,MelonLoader会自动加载UnityExplorer。
验证:游戏启动后,UnityExplorer界面会自动加载,表明安装成功。
Standalone独立安装方式
准备:在Unity编辑器中打开Package Manager,准备好UnityExplorer的package.json文件。
执行:
- 在Package Manager中导入UnityExplorer的package.json文件。
- 将UnityExplorer预制体拖入场景,或创建GameObject并添加ExplorerEditorBehaviour脚本。
验证:进入游戏运行模式,若能正常使用UnityExplorer的各项功能,则安装成功。
环境兼容性检测清单
在安装UnityExplorer之前,请确保你的环境满足以下条件:
- Unity版本:5.2及以上
- 操作系统:Windows 7/8/10/11
- 游戏引擎类型:支持加密与非加密游戏引擎
- 框架要求(根据安装方式):BepInEx或MelonLoader(对应安装方式)
三种安装方式性能对比表
| 安装方式 | 启动速度 | 资源占用 | 功能丰富度 | 兼容性 |
|---|---|---|---|---|
| BepInEx | 快 | 低 | 高 | 好 |
| MelonLoader | 中 | 中 | 高 | 较好 |
| Standalone | 较慢 | 较高 | 中 | 一般 |
深度应用:调试场景实战案例
案例一:游戏对象属性修改
在游戏运行时,通过UnityExplorer的对象资源管理器找到目标游戏对象,在场景检查器中修改其属性值,如位置、旋转、缩放等,实时观察游戏效果,快速定位问题。
案例二:C#代码调试
利用C#控制台功能,输入代码片段并执行,测试逻辑是否正确。例如,通过代码获取游戏对象的组件,调用其方法,验证功能是否正常。
案例三:场景资源搜索与管理
使用对象搜索功能,快速找到场景中的特定资源,查看其属性和引用关系,便于进行资源优化和管理。
问题速查卡片
安装后无法启动?
- 检查MOD框架版本是否与UnityExplorer兼容。
- 确认文件放置位置是否正确,BepInEx方式应放在plugins目录,MelonLoader方式应放在Mods目录。
- 查看游戏日志文件,排查错误信息。
界面显示异常?
- 尝试调整UnityExplorer的显示设置,如窗口大小、分辨率等。
- 检查游戏分辨率设置,确保与UnityExplorer界面兼容。
- 确保有足够的屏幕空间显示界面,关闭其他占用屏幕空间的程序。
通过本文的介绍,相信你已经对UnityExplorer的安装和使用有了全面的了解。选择适合自己的安装方式,按照步骤进行配置,你就能快速上手这款强大的Unity调试工具,让你的游戏开发和MOD制作工作更加高效。🔧🛠️🎯
【免费下载链接】UnityExplorerAn in-game UI for exploring, debugging and modifying IL2CPP and Mono Unity games.项目地址: https://gitcode.com/gh_mirrors/un/UnityExplorer
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考